Few European dance music producers have influenced commercial club music as much as Gigi D’Agostino. Emerging from Italy’s thriving 1990s dance scene, he became one of the defining artists of the Mediterranean Progressive and Italo dance movement. His productions combined uplifting melodies, memorable hooks, minimal rhythms and emotionally driven synth lines that helped bring underground club sounds into the mainstream.

This list contains Gigi D’Agostino’s fifty most commercially successful and recognisable official releases, prioritised using available worldwide chart performance, international popularity, certifications, longevity, streaming success and historical significance. Since detailed worldwide sales figures are unavailable for many European dance releases from the 1990s, the ranking also considers international chart success, enduring popularity and music industry consensus. His biggest international breakthroughs such as L’Amour Toujours, Bla Bla Bla, Another Way, The Riddle and La Passion remain staples of clubs, festivals, sporting events and radio stations more than two decades after their original release. His catalogue continues to attract millions of monthly listeners and several tracks have enjoyed renewed popularity through streaming platforms and social media.

Unlike many DJs whose careers are built around remixes, Gigi D’Agostino is recognised for creating original productions that became global dance anthems. His music helped define late 1990s and early 2000s European dance culture while inspiring generations of producers and DJs. The continued success of L’Amour Toujours and the global hit In My Mind with Dynoro demonstrates the lasting appeal of his music across multiple generations.

History

Gigi D’Agostino began DJing in Turin during the mid 1980s before joining the Media Records production team. During the late 1990s he became one of Italy’s biggest dance exports through releases on the BXR label.

His breakthrough came with L’Amour Toujours, Bla Bla Bla, Another Way and The Riddle, which charted across Europe and helped define commercial dance music entering the new millennium.

His music experienced a major resurgence in the streaming era, with L’Amour Toujours becoming a global classic and In My Mind, a collaboration with Dynoro built around the melody from L’Amour Toujours, becoming one of the biggest dance hits of 2018.

10 Fun Facts

  1. Gigi D’Agostino’s real name is Luigino Celestino Di Agostino.
  2. He is regarded as one of the pioneers of Mediterranean Progressive Dance.
  3. L’Amour Toujours remains one of the most streamed dance songs from the late 1990s.
  4. Bla Bla Bla features almost no traditional lyrics.
  5. His version of The Riddle is a cover of the Nik Kershaw classic.
  6. The BXR label became synonymous with his signature sound.
  7. His productions have influenced countless European DJs and producers.
  8. He has used several aliases during his career, including Gigi Dag and Lento Violento.
  9. His music continues to be played regularly at sporting events and festivals worldwide.
  10. More than twenty five years after its release, L’Amour Toujours remains one of the defining anthems of European dance music.
